Appalling service levels (Not Recommended)


Pros The cashconnect system is very easy to use. invoices can be put on easily, and a number of generic reports can be raised quickly.

Cons Service levels are absoutely shocking. On at least 4 occassions within 6 months Lloyds have been asked to address something business critical. On every occassion between 2 and 4 weeks notice was given, but nothing happened until the last day.

As Ou C mentioned, Lloyds will happily withdraw funding at the drop of a hat. I have resolved 2 of the 3 issues within an afternoon and the 3rd one will be done within 48 hours. I had no communication from Lloyds to let me know that there was a problem, and the only time I found out was when funds were not available in my account.

I have the factoring service and in 4 months Lloyds have managed to collect less than 10% of the overall ledger, when my payment terms are 14 days as standard. Again, I was not told about this until funding was pulled.

I would thoroughly recommend avoiding these services at all cost. They are run by a bunch of amateurs who have no idea how to help a small and growing business.

Decisions on a whim (Not Recommended)


Pros The automated parts of the service is very good. There isn't a problem with inputting your invoices, receiving your money and getting reports.

Cons Customer services is attrocious.

The customer contact is haphazard. We don't know what contact is being made with our customer and when the customer calls as to find out what the query is no one at LTSBCF can tell us what contact they have had with the customer.

You can get funding withdrawn with no warning whatsoever and based on a whim. LTSBCF don't seem to understand that if they have concerns they need to discuss it with the customer and give the customer a deadline to sort out issues, if any, before withdrawing funding. On the occassions that LTSBCF have withdrawn funding without warning the issue has been sorted within hours.
